Каков означают JSON-формат и XML
JSON а-также XML-формат являют по-сути стандарты пересылки данными, они задействуются ради передачи данных между несколькими программами. Данные-стандарты задействуются для создании-сайтов, связке систем, работе с API-интерфейсами и размещении структурированных данных. Главная функция этих структур состоит во этом, чтобы создать понятный плюс стандартизированный формат представления сведений.
Во электронной инфраструктуре информация необходимо передаваться для приложениями плюс серверными-частями, при-этом дополнительно между несколькими сервисами. В-рамках прикладных примерах а-также аналитических разборах, охватывая 1хбет, часто демонстрируется, по-какой-схеме JSON-формат а-также XML-формат используются с-целью обеспечения передачи информацией, согласования информации а-также связи среди платформами.
Какое такое JavaScript-Object-Notation
JSON-формат, или JavaScript объектная нотация, образует по-сути легковесный способ данных, базирующийся на-основе структуре элементов и массивов. Данный-формат применяет 1xbet строчный формат, который удобно воспринимается а-также анализируется и специалистом, так а-также приложениями. JSON-формат часто применяется в веб-приложениях и API.
Информация внутри JSON-формате структурированы в формате пар «ключ–значение». Поле обозначает по-сути название поля, а значение способно выступать строкой, цифровым-значением, логическим значением, массивом или внутренним структурой. Данная модель формирует этот-формат подходящим ради хранения а-также передачи сведений.
JSON отличается лаконичностью и простотой. Данный-формат не требует трудных условий оформления, вследствие-этого JSON проще использовать во работе со другими структурами. Такая-особенность формирует JSON популярным выбором 1хбет ради актуальных приложений.
Что представляет XML-формат
XML-формат, то-есть Extensible Markup язык, представляет из-себя стандарт разметки, который задействуется для хранения а-также передачи данных. XML основан на задействовании разметочных-тегов, они задают структуру информации. XML дает-возможность формировать пользовательские обозначения и определять их значения.
Сведения в XML помещаются внутрь теги, что включают начальную и финальную секцию. Данная структура формирует формат значительно строгим а-также регламентированным. Extensible-Markup-Language применяется во многочисленных платформах, в-которых требуется строгое представление организации информации 1х бет.
Extensible-Markup-Language выделяется универсальностью плюс гибкостью. Данный-формат помогает описывать сложные модели плюс применять дополнительные-свойства для конкретизации параметров. Такая-возможность формирует XML удобным для задач, в-которых необходима четкая схема данных.
Ключевые отличия JSON а-также XML-формата
JavaScript-Object-Notation и Extensible-Markup-Language закрывают схожую роль, но получают разные принципы ко представлению сведений. JSON-формат применяет намного лаконичный способ-записи плюс меньше знаков, это создает формат кратким. Extensible-Markup-Language использует значительно-больше дополнительных элементов, это повышает размер данных.
JSON-формат удобнее читается плюс оперативнее интерпретируется во большинстве нынешних приложений. XML, со отдельную очередь, дает более-широкие возможностей с-целью контроля структуры и валидации информации. Определение 1xbet для ними формируется на-основе задач отдельной платформы.
Также меняется метод взаимодействия с сведениями. JavaScript-Object-Notation чаще задействуется для онлайн-сервисах а-также интерфейсах-API, тогда как XML-формат применяется во enterprise решениях, описаниях плюс передаче упорядоченной данными.
Схема JSON-формата
JavaScript-Object-Notation состоит из элементов а-также массивов. Объект формирует из-себя набор связок ключ-значение, заключенных во фигурные символы. Массив обозначает из-себя перечень данных, обернутых в служебные скобки.
Любое значение внутри JavaScript-Object-Notation имеет-возможность быть элементарным либо сложным. Элементарные 1хбет значения содержат символы, числа плюс логические значения. Составные данные содержат наборы и дочерние объекты. Подобная организация позволяет представлять развитые данные.
JSON не поддерживает комментарии а-также формальную типизацию, данный-фактор упрощает его применение. При-этом такой-подход требует контроля при работе через сведениями, чтобы предотвратить неточностей.
Схема XML-формата
XML-формат задействует многоуровневую схему, построенную вокруг внутренних элементах. Отдельный блок содержит имя плюс имеет-возможность 1х бет содержать информацию или другие теги. Такая-структура позволяет описывать сложные структуры сведений.
Блоки XML-формата могут включать дополнительные-свойства, что конкретизируют данные. Параметры помещаются в-рамках стартового тега и добавляют вспомогательный этап детализации.
XML требует строгого соблюдения регламентов оформления. Каждые блоки должны становиться оформлены, а организация необходимо оставаться правильной. Данный-фактор создает данный-стандарт более формальным, но поддерживает стабильность данных.
Области-применения JSON
JSON широко используется для веб-разработке. Он 1xbet применяется ради передачи данных для клиентом плюс сервером, а также ради взаимодействия со интерфейсами-API. За-счет своей легкости JSON является основой во нынешних сервисах.
JavaScript-Object-Notation используется для mobile системах, платформах анализа а-также интеграции сервисов. Данный-формат позволяет быстро отправлять сведения плюс анализировать данные без трудных обработок.
Кроме-того JSON-формат применяется с-целью размещения конфигураций и параметров. JSON структура создает формат практичным для описания параметров плюс их повторного 1хбет использования.
Использование Extensible-Markup-Language
Extensible-Markup-Language применяется для платформах, в-которых требуется формальная структура данных. Он используется для enterprise платформах, обмене документами и связке различных систем.
XML часто задействуется для регламентах пересылки сведениями, таких как системные документы, записи плюс данные. XML расширяемость помогает адаптировать схему под конкретные задачи.
Кроме-того XML-формат используется во платформах, в-которых необходима валидация сведений. Существуют служебные схемы, они дают-возможность валидировать корректность схемы и содержимого.
Плюсы и недостатки
JSON-формат обладает набор достоинств, такие-как простоту, малый-объем плюс скорость обработки. Он практичен с-целью разработчиков плюс эффективно используется с-целью актуальных систем. Однако 1х бет JSON возможности контроля организации менее-широкие.
Extensible-Markup-Language дает более расширенные средства для контроля информации. XML включает валидации, параметры а-также жесткую схему. Данный-фактор создает XML подходящим для развитых решений, при-этом повышает объем сведений а-также нагрузку обработки.
Определение для JavaScript-Object-Notation плюс XML формируется на-основе условий. В-случае-если необходима быстрота и легкость, обычно используется JSON. Когда критична формальная структура а-также контроль данных, задействуется XML.
Разбор JavaScript-Object-Notation плюс XML
С-целью взаимодействия с JSON-форматом а-также Extensible-Markup-Language используются специальные средства плюс пакеты. Они дают-возможность читать, записывать и изменять информацию. В большинстве сред программирования доступна базовая обработка данных 1xbet стандартов.
Разбор JSON-формата как-правило быстрее, так-как как JSON организация лаконичнее. Extensible-Markup-Language требует значительно-больше вычислений из-за сложной организации а-также потребности проверки разметки.
Перевод данных между структурами дополнительно возможно. Это позволяет связывать сервисы, применяющие разные структуры. Подобные действия обычно запускаются без-ручного-участия с-помощью помощью специальных модулей 1хбет.
Значение JSON и XML во нынешних платформах
JSON-формат а-также XML считаются важными частями онлайн среды. Данные-стандарты обеспечивают обмен данными для системами плюс позволяют разрабатывать интеграции. В-случае-отсутствия указанных структур обмен для системами становилось-бы бы существенно менее-удобным.
JSON-формат стал основным стандартом ради web-приложений а-также интерфейсов-API за-счет данной понятности и практичности. Extensible-Markup-Language поддерживает отдельную важность во платформах, где нужна формальная схема и валидация данных.
Два формата продолжают использоваться и развиваться. JSON-и-XML остаются основными средствами ради пересылки данных а-также построения электронных 1х бет платформ.
Дополнительные черты структур
JSON-формат а-также XML выделяются не исключительно форматом-записи, однако а-также подходом для работе через данными. JavaScript-Object-Notation обычно применяется в-роли стандарт обмена, в-то-время как Extensible-Markup-Language имеет-возможность задействоваться в-роли для пересылки, так а-также ради хранения сведений. Это соотносится из-за тем-фактом, что XML дает-возможность задавать более сложные модели плюс условия валидации.
Во JavaScript-Object-Notation не-предусмотрена функция заметок, что создает JSON намного строгим с-точки-зрения точки зрения организации. Во Extensible-Markup-Language 1xbet комментарии поддерживаются, что ускоряет пояснение данных. Однако такой-подход еще повышает массу и способно замедлять разбор.
Дополнительно значимой чертой выступает чувствительность к регистру. Внутри JavaScript-Object-Notation поля строги ко case, данный-фактор нуждается-в аккуратности при работе. Во XML дополнительно важно соблюдать правильное оформление элементов, поскольку как неточность в обозначении может создать для некорректной валидации.
Эффективность плюс оптимальность
JSON-формат как-правило обрабатывается быстрее, поскольку потому-что JSON схема лаконичнее и нуждается-в меньшего-объема вычислений. Данный-фактор 1хбет в-частности важно в-условиях обработке с значительными объемами информации и значительными нагрузками. JavaScript-Object-Notation часто задействуется для системах, где необходима скорость отклика.
XML-формат требует увеличенного-объема мощностей для разбора, так-как потому-что нужно анализировать организацию элементов а-также контролировать их валидность. Однако данная-особенность уравновешивается наличием строгой проверки данных а-также расширяемостью организации.
При подборе стандарта критично принимать-во-внимание требования проекта. Когда главным-фактором выступает скорость плюс компактность, обычно задействуется JSON-формат. Когда необходима четкая-организация а-также проверка информации, применяется 1х бет XML-формат.
Leave a Reply